3 MW bundled Wind Power project at Ambaliyara and Jangi Villages, district Kutch, Gujarat, India, implemented by M/s Terapanth Foods Limited and Kutch Salt & Allied Industries Limited.

Audit Analysis
A straightforward CDM wind power project using the standard AMS-I.D. methodology with a jurisdictional grid baseline and VVB-confirmed investment additionality. The project delivered approximately 81% of its pro-rata emission reduction expectation over the elapsed monitoring period, consistent with wind variability. Minor gaps exist in safeguards documentation and CORSIA/CCP eligibility status, but no material findings or corrective actions were reported.
Red Flags
- Safeguards are mentioned in the documents but FPIC and grievance mechanism details are not found in the extracted record, leaving the adequacy of stakeholder engagement unverified
- CORSIA eligibility and CCP status are not stated in any available document, creating uncertainty about dual-channel crediting risk
- Grid emission factor shows a minor discrepancy between the monitoring report (0.90589 tCO2/MWh) and the financial document (897.12, likely gCO2/kWh), a ~1% difference that should be reconciled
